To defect?

Hi. Can I use defect in the following sentences? Is there a better alternative?

I used to be a huge fan of Amd, now I've defected to Nvidia.

I defected to Messi's side from Ronaldo's after I saw how well he played this season.

By Messi's side, I meant I now think Messi is the best now, not Ronaldo who I thought he was.

"To defect" means to abandon one side in a conflict for the opposing side. Your usage is fine in the slightly hyperbolic sense of turning the issue of market share or fandom into a figurative battle. It would be more straightforward if lower key to use "prefer."
